Job description

Position Overview

Position Overview: The Quality Manager will provide support for product/process quality activities within PICA. Areas of assignment may include customer complaints, product failure investigations, corrective actions, Product/Process improvement efforts, documenting FAIR activities, writing, and updating work instructions, inspections and checklists, and quality system support. Work with the manufacturing team to analyze problems and opportunities and plan for improvements.

Responsibilities
  • Act as the primary management representative for Pica Manufacturing Solutions & Pica Product Development ISO 9001 & ISO 13485 certifications
  • Oversee the CAR, SCAR, & NCMR system
  • Generating operating procedures as required
  • Analyze and report on supplier quality metrics
  • Work with suppliers to improve overall performance (FAIR & CPK)
  • Report on company quality metrics
  • Direct process/product improvement efforts
  • Direct supply partners on quality and failure analysis efforts
  • Interface with customers on quality related issues
  • Interface with supply partners on quality related issues
  • Ensure the company complies with statutory & regulatory requirements
  • Implementation and maintain the Quality Management System
  • Maintain documentation control system
  • Perform and review supplier audits
  • Review and approve internal audits
  • Oversee all aspects of incoming, in process, and final inspection
  • Undertake additional responsibilities or activities as required by the Quality Director
  • Ability and willingness to travel domestically and internationally to support supplier audits, customer meetings, and global manufacturing alignment
Knowledge & Skills
  • Understand quality systems, ISO 9001 & 13485 standards
  • Ability to troubleshoot issues for components, materials, tools, programs, equipment, and Electrical Test
  •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Ability to create, review, and revise operating procedures, work instructions
  • Specific training and demonstrated success in applying quality problem-solving methods, such as fishbone diagrams, 5 why, FMEA, process capability analysis, hypothesis testing, DoE, SPC, etc
  • Excellent oral, written, and presentation communication skills (PICA has locations and customers domestic & overseas)
  • Electrical testing experience – an advantage
  • Statistical software capabilities
  • Effective multitasking, organization, and prioritization skills
  • High attention to detail
  • Ability to work effectively with frequent shifts in direction
  • Knowledge of and ability to apply the principles of Six Sigma (preferred)
